CNP Stock Today: February 15 — Houston Storm Outages Hit 11K Customers
The CenterPoint outage on February 15 left about 11,000 Houston customers without power after severe storms. For investors, this raises questions about near-term O&M costs, service reliability, and future grid-hardening capex. CenterPoint Energy, ticker CNP, recently traded at $42.52 after touching a 52-week high of $42.57. With earnings scheduled for February 19, we expect management to outline restoration costs, timeline impacts, and regulatory recovery paths.
